SAConfettiView alternatives and similar libraries
Based on the "UI" category.
Alternatively, view SAConfettiView alternatives based on common mentions on social networks and blogs.
Charts10.0 7.6 L1 SAConfettiView VS ChartsBeautiful charts for iOS/tvOS/OSX! The Apple side of the crossplatform MPAndroidChart.
Hero9.9 4.2 L2 SAConfettiView VS HeroElegant transition library for iOS & tvOS
Material9.9 0.0 L2 SAConfettiView VS MaterialA UI/UX framework for creating beautiful applications.
Animated Tab Bar9.8 0.0 L5 SAConfettiView VS Animated Tab Bar:octocat: RAMAnimatedTabBarController is a Swift UI module library for adding animation to iOS tabbar items and icons. iOS library made by @Ramotion
Eureka9.8 3.2 L2 SAConfettiView VS EurekaElegant iOS form builder in Swift
LTMorphingLabel9.8 0.0 L3 SAConfettiView VS LTMorphingLabel[EXPERIMENTAL] Graceful morphing effects for UILabel written in Swift.
NVActivityIndicatorView9.8 0.0 L2 SAConfettiView VS NVActivityIndicatorViewA collection of awesome loading animations
folding-cell9.8 0.0 L4 SAConfettiView VS folding-cell:octocat: 📃 FoldingCell is an expanding content cell with animation made by @Ramotion
FSPagerView9.7 0.0 L2 SAConfettiView VS FSPagerViewFSPagerView is an elegant Screen Slide Library. It is extremely helpful for making Banner View、Product Show、Welcome/Guide Pages、Screen/ViewController Sliders.
JTAppleCalendar9.7 0.0 L1 SAConfettiView VS JTAppleCalendarThe Unofficial Apple iOS Swift Calendar View. Swift calendar Library. iOS calendar Control. 100% Customizable
XLPagerTabStrip9.7 0.0 L4 SAConfettiView VS XLPagerTabStripAndroid PagerTabStrip for iOS.
SwiftMessages9.7 0.0 L2 SAConfettiView VS SwiftMessagesA very flexible message bar for iOS written in Swift.
Pagemenu9.6 0.0 L2 SAConfettiView VS PagemenuA paging menu controller built from other view controllers placed inside a scroll view (like Spotify, Windows Phone, Instagram)
Alerts Pickers9.6 0.0 SAConfettiView VS Alerts PickersAdvanced usage of UIAlertController and pickers based on it: Telegram, Contacts, Location, PhotoLibrary, Country, Phone Code, Currency, Date...
AMScrollingNavbar9.6 0.0 L4 SAConfettiView VS AMScrollingNavbarScrollable UINavigationBar that follows the scrolling of a UIScrollView
SwiftEntryKit9.6 0.0 SAConfettiView VS SwiftEntryKitSwiftEntryKit is a presentation library for iOS. It can be used to easily display overlays within your iOS apps.
Macaw9.6 0.0 L2 SAConfettiView VS MacawPowerful and easy-to-use vector graphics Swift library with SVG support
TextFieldEffects9.6 0.0 L5 SAConfettiView VS TextFieldEffectsCustom UITextFields effects inspired by Codrops, built using Swift
SwipeCellKit9.6 0.0 L5 SAConfettiView VS SwipeCellKitSwipeable UITableViewCell/UICollectionViewCell based on the stock Mail.app, implemented in Swift.
PermissionScope9.5 0.0 L3 SAConfettiView VS PermissionScopeA Periscope-inspired way to ask for iOS permissions.
SPPermission9.5 7.9 SAConfettiView VS SPPermissionUniversal API for request permission and get its statuses.
ImagePicker9.5 0.0 L5 SAConfettiView VS ImagePicker:camera: Reinventing the way ImagePicker works.
Scrollable-GraphView9.5 0.0 L3 SAConfettiView VS Scrollable-GraphViewAn adaptive scrollable graph view for iOS to visualise simple discrete datasets. Written in Swift.
SideMenu9.5 0.0 L5 SAConfettiView VS SideMenuSimple side/slide menu control for iOS, no code necessary! Lots of customization. Add it to your project in 5 minutes or less.
Material Components for iOS[In maintenance mode] Modular and customizable Material Design UI components for iOS
SCLAlertView9.5 0.0 L2 SAConfettiView VS SCLAlertViewBeautiful animated Alert View. Written in Swift
ActiveLabel9.4 0.0 L4 SAConfettiView VS ActiveLabelUILabel drop-in replacement supporting Hashtags (#), Mentions (@) and URLs (http://) written in Swift
Instructions9.4 4.7 L4 SAConfettiView VS InstructionsCreate walkthroughs and guided tours (coach marks) in a simple way, with Swift.
NotificationBannerThe easiest way to display highly customizable in app notification banners in iOS
ESTabBarController:octocat: ESTabBarController is a Swift model for customize UI, badge and adding animation to tabbar items. Support lottie!
BulletinBoard9.4 0.0 SAConfettiView VS BulletinBoardGeneral-purpose contextual cards for iOS
PopupDialog9.3 0.0 L2 SAConfettiView VS PopupDialogA simple, customizable popup dialog for iOS written in Swift. Replaces UIAlertController alert style.
TLYShyNavBar9.3 0.0 L4 SAConfettiView VS TLYShyNavBarUnlike all those arrogant UINavigationBar, this one is shy and humble! Easily create auto-scrolling navigation bars!
Siren9.3 5.2 L4 SAConfettiView VS SirenNotify users when a new version of your app is available and prompt them to upgrade.
SlideMenuControllerSwift9.3 0.0 L3 SAConfettiView VS SlideMenuControllerSwiftiOS Slide Menu View based on Google+, iQON, Feedly, Ameba iOS app. It is written in pure swift.
PKHUD9.3 0.0 L4 SAConfettiView VS PKHUDA Swift based reimplementation of the Apple HUD (Volume, Ringer, Rotation,…) for iOS 8.
BouncyLayout9.2 0.0 SAConfettiView VS BouncyLayoutMake. It. Bounce.
PanelKit9.2 0.0 L4 SAConfettiView VS PanelKitA UI framework that enables panels on iOS.
KMNavigationBarTransition9.2 0.0 L5 SAConfettiView VS KMNavigationBarTransitionA drop-in universal library helps you to manage the navigation bar styles and makes transition animations smooth between different navigation bar styles while pushing or popping a view controller for all orientations. And you don't need to write any line of code for it, it all happens automatically.
DGElasticPullToRefresh9.2 0.0 L4 SAConfettiView VS DGElasticPullToRefreshElastic pull to refresh for iOS developed in Swift
Cards XI9.2 0.0 SAConfettiView VS Cards XIAwesome iOS 11 appstore cards in swift 5.
StarWars.iOS9.2 0.0 L5 SAConfettiView VS StarWars.iOSThis component implements transition animation to crumble view-controller into tiny pieces.
Whisper9.2 0.0 L4 SAConfettiView VS Whisper:mega: Whisper is a component that will make the task of display messages and in-app notifications simple. It has three different views inside
Persei9.2 0.0 L5 SAConfettiView VS PerseiAnimated top menu for UITableView / UICollectionView / UIScrollView written in Swift
Parchment9.1 0.0 SAConfettiView VS ParchmentA paging view controller with a highly customizable menu ✨
DOFavoriteButton9.1 0.0 L3 SAConfettiView VS DOFavoriteButtonCute Animated Button written in Swift.
XLActionController9.1 0.0 L4 SAConfettiView VS XLActionControllerFully customizable and extensible action sheet controller written in Swift
RazzleDazzle9.1 0.0 L5 SAConfettiView VS RazzleDazzleA simple keyframe-based animation framework for iOS, written in Swift. Perfect for scrolling app intros.
PaperOnboarding9.1 0.0 L5 SAConfettiView VS PaperOnboarding:octocat: PaperOnboarding is a material design UI slider. Swift UI library by @Ramotion
CircleMenu9.1 0.0 L5 SAConfettiView VS CircleMenu:octocat: ⭕️ CircleMenu is a simple, elegant UI menu with a circular layout and material design animations. Swift UI library made by @Ramotion
Appwrite - The Open Source Firebase alternative introduces iOS support
* Code Quality Rankings and insights are calculated and provided by Lumnify.
They vary from L1 to L5 with "L5" being the highest.
Do you think we are missing an alternative of SAConfettiView or a related project?
It's raining confetti! SAConfettiView is the easiest way to add fun, multi-colored confetti to your application and make users feel rewarded. Written in Swift, SAConfettiView is a subclass of UIView and is highly customizable. From various types and colors of confetti to different levels of intensity, you can make the confetti as fancy as you want.
SAConfettiView is available through CocoaPods. To install it, simply add the following line to your Podfile:
And then run:
$ pod install
To manually install SAConfettiView, simply add
SAConfettiView.swift to your project.
Creating a SAConfettiView is the same as creating a UIView:
let confettiView = SAConfettiView(frame: self.view.bounds)
Don't forget to add the subview!
Pick one of the preconfigured types of confetti with the
.type property, or create your own by providing a custom image. This property defaults to the
confettiView.type = .Confetti
confettiView.type = .Triangle
confettiView.type = .Star
confettiView.type = .Diamond
confettiView.type = .Image(UIImage(named: "smiley"))
Set the colors of the confetti with the
.colors property. This property has a default value of multiple colors.
confettiView.colors = [UIColor.redColor(), UIColor.greenColor(), UIColor.blueColor()]
The intensity refers to how many particles are generated and how quickly they fall. Set the intensity of the confetti with the
.intensity property by passing in a value between 0 and 1. The default intensity is 0.5.
confettiView.intensity = 0.75
To start the confetti, use
To stop the confetti, use
To check if the confetti is active and currently being displayed, use
true if it is being displayed, and
false if it is not.
- Add Storyboard support SlaunchaMan #1
Copyright (c) 2015 Sudeep Agarwal
Permission is hereby granted, free of charge, to any person obtaining a copy of this software and associated documentation files (the "Software"), to deal in the Software without restriction, including without limitation the rights to use, copy, modify, merge, publish, distribute, sublicense, and/or sell copies of the Software, and to permit persons to whom the Software is furnished to do so, subject to the following conditions:
The above copyright notice and this permission notice shall be included in all copies or substantial portions of the Software.
THE SOFTWARE IS PROVIDED "AS IS", WITHOUT WARRANTY OF ANY KIND, EXPRESS OR IMPLIED, INCLUDING BUT NOT LIMITED TO THE WARRANTIES OF MERCHANTABILITY, FITNESS FOR A PARTICULAR PURPOSE AND NONINFRINGEMENT. IN NO EVENT SHALL THE AUTHORS OR COPYRIGHT HOLDERS BE LIABLE FOR ANY CLAIM, DAMAGES OR OTHER LIABILITY, WHETHER IN AN ACTION OF CONTRACT, TORT OR OTHERWISE, ARISING FROM, OUT OF OR IN C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N THE SOFTWARE.
*Note that all licence references and agreements mentioned in the SAConfettiView README section above are relevant to that project's source code only.